Innovative Sound Engineering: The Edge’s Approach to Immersive Audio
To capture U2’s distinctive sound in a revolutionary way, The Edge and the production team employed cutting-edge spatial audio technologies that surpass conventional surround sound. By utilizing ambisonics and object-based audio mixing,the film’s soundscape dynamically adapts to the viewer’s movements and position within the Sphere environment. This technique allows listeners to experience every subtle guitar nuance, vocal expression, and drum rhythm as though enveloped by the live performance itself.Achieving this level of audio fidelity required close collaboration among sound engineers, acousticians, and visual effects experts to seamlessly integrate sound and imagery.
Highlights of the sound design innovations include:
- Multi-channel audio arrays simulating a 360-degree auditory environment
- Real-time audio localization providing personalized listening experiences
- Advanced recording capturing ambient crowd noise and venue acoustics
- Adaptive mixing algorithms tailored to the Sphere’s unique architectural sound profile
Technique | Purpose | Advantage |
---|---|---|
Ambisonics | Encode three-dimensional sound fields | Creates immersive environmental realism |
Object-Based Mixing | Position individual audio elements dynamically | Delivers customized audio perspectives |
Spatial Array Recording | Capture authentic concert atmosphere | Enhances live experience authenticity |
